Ingredients

  • ½ cup packed brown sugar
  • 8 tablespoons butter
  • ½ cup gold rum (such as Bacardi Gold®)
  • ¼ cup dark molasses
  • 3 tablespoons spicy mustard
  • 1 tablespoon cider vinegar
  • salt and pepper to taste

Information

  • Prep Time: 5 mins
  • Cook Time: 8 mins
  • Total Time: 13 mins
  • Servings: 10
  • Yield: 1 1/2 cups glaze

  • Combine brown sugar, butter, rum, molasses, mustard, and cider vinegar in a large saucepan over medium heat. Bring to a boil, and reduce heat to low. Simmer, stirring constantly, until sugar has melted and the glaze has thickened, about 8 minutes.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
  • Nutrition

    177 cal.

    • Total Fat: 10g
    • Saturated Fat: 6g
    • Cholesterol: 24mg
    • Sodium: 130mg
    • Total Carbohydrate: 17g
    • Total Sugars: 15g
    • Protein: 0g
    • Calcium: 34mg
    • Iron: 1mg
    • Potassium: 145mg
